Aimerce First‑Party Pixel and Snapchat Ads both aim to enhance advertising effectiveness for Shopify merchants, but they differ significantly in scope and approach. Aimerce First‑Party Pixel focuses on optimizing data collection through a first-party pixel, likely improving ad targeting and attribution across various platforms. This indicates a broader advertising strategy enhancer rather than a platform-specific solution. Snapchat Ads, on the other hand, directly integrates with the Snapchat advertising platform, enabling merchants to create and manage campaigns specifically for Snapchat users. Thus, the target audience for Snapchat Ads are merchants who actively want to advertise on Snapchat. A key difference is the level of platform specificity. Aimerce leans toward a general ad optimization tool, while Snapchat Ads is specifically for Snapchat. The review count also reflects this difference. The Snapchat Ads app, with significantly more reviews (689) compared to Aimerce First-Party Pixel (59), suggests a longer presence in the market and possibly a wider user base. However, Aimerce's perfect 5/5 rating, while based on fewer reviews, might indicate a highly specialized and effective solution for its target user base. The number of reviews suggests more merchant experience with the Snapchat Ads platform, therefore there could be more available tutorials and external user created resources available for users to leverage.

For merchants whose primary advertising channel is Snapchat, the Snapchat Ads app is the clear choice, offering direct integration and campaign management tools. However, if a merchant seeks to improve overall ad targeting and attribution by leveraging first-party data, regardless of the specific ad platform, Aimerce First-Party Pixel could be the better option. Aimerce's higher rating indicates that users value its functionality highly, though the smaller number of reviews makes it difficult to draw firm conclusions. Merchants with limited advertising experience may find Snapchat Ads easier to use due to its platform-specific focus and possibly more readily available resources and tutorials.
Ultimately, the best app depends on the merchant's specific advertising goals and platform preferences.
